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
informatika.doc
Скачиваний:
182
Добавлен:
09.02.2015
Размер:
2.05 Mб
Скачать

279. Задание {{ 374 }} тз № 374

Отметьте правильный ответ

Исполнитель Чертежник может выполнять команды:

опустить - коснуться пером бумаги;

поднять - оторвать перо от бумаги;

сместиться в точку (x, y) - Чертежник сместит перо в точку с координатами (x, y).

Повтори n [команда 1, команда 2,…, команда m] означает, что последовательность команд в квадратных скобках повторится n раз.

Начальное положение Чертежника точка с координатами (0, 0).

Дан фрагмент алгоритма:

x=0, опустить, повтори 10 [x:= x + 1/10, сместиться в точку (x, 3**x)], поднять

(** - возведение в степень).

В этом фрагменте алгоритма Чертежник нарисует

 нарисует график функции y=3x на участке от 0 до 1 в виде ломаной из 10 звеньев

280. Задание {{ 375 }} ТЗ № 375

Отметьте правильный ответ

Определите значение k после выполнения фрагмента программы, если

N=6, A=(1, -1, 2, -2, 3, -3)

Pascal

QBasic

ШАЯ

k:=0;

For i:=1 to N do

If A[i]<0 then

k:=k+A[i];

k=0

FOR i=1 TO N

IF A(i)<0 THEN

k=k+A(i)

END IF

NEXT i

K:=0

нц для i от 1 до N

если A[i]<0

то k:=k+A[i]

все

кц

 -6

281. Задание {{ 376 }} ТЗ № 376

Отметьте правильный ответ

Определите значение k после выполнения фрагмента программы, если

N=6, A=(1, -1, 2, -2, 3, -3)

Pascal

QBasic

ШАЯ

k:=1;

For i:=1 to N do

If A[i]>0 Then

k:=k*A[i];

k=1

FOR i=1 TO N

IF A(i)>0 THEN

k=k*A(i)

END IF

NEXT i

K:=1

нц для i от 1 до N

если A[i]>0

то k:=k*A[i]

все

кц

 6

282. Задание {{ 377 }} ТЗ № 377

Отметьте правильный ответ

Определите значение k после выполнения фрагмента программы, если

N=6, A=(1, -1, 2, -2, 3, -3)

Pascal

QBasic

ШАЯ

K:=0;

For i:=1 to N do

If A[i]>0 Then

k:=k+1;

k=0

FOR i=1 TO N

IF A(i)>0 THEN

k=k+1

END IF

NEXT i

K:=0

нц для i от 1 до N

если A[i]>0

то k:=k+1

все

кц

 3

283. Задание {{ 378 }} ТЗ № 378

Отметьте правильный ответ

Определите, чему равно k после выполнения программы:

Pascal

K:=0;

For i:=50 To 815 Do

If i mod 60 = 6 Then k:=k+1;

Basic

k=0

FOR i=50 TO 815

IF i MOD 60 = 6 THEN k=k+1

NEXT i

ШАЯ

k:=0;

НЦ Для i От 50 До 815

Если mod(i, 60) = 6 То k:=k+1;

КЦ

 13

284. Задание {{ 379 }} ТЗ № 379

Отметьте правильный ответ

Определите, чему равно k после выполнения программы:

Pascal

K:=0;

For i:=0 To 825 Do

If i mod 60 = 4 Then k:=k+1;

Basic

k=0

FOR i=0 TO 825

IF i MOD 60 = 4 THEN k=k+1

NEXT i

ШАЯ

k:=0;

НЦ Для i От 0 До 825

Если mod(i, 60) = 4 То k:=k+1;

КЦ

 14

285. Задание {{ 380 }} ТЗ № 380

Отметьте правильный ответ

Определите, чему равно k после выполнения программы:

Pascal

K:=0;

For i:=50 To 555 Do

If i mod 60 = 4 Then k:=k+1;

Basic

k=0

FOR i=50 TO 555

IF i MOD 60 = 4 THEN k=k+1

NEXT i

ШАЯ

k:=0;

НЦ Для i От 50 До 555

Если mod(i, 60) = 4 То k:=k+1;

КЦ

 9

286. Задание {{ 381 }} ТЗ № 381

Отметьте правильный ответ

Определите, чему равно k после выполнения программы:

Pascal

K:=0;

For i:=90 To 585 Do

If i mod 40 = 7 Then k:=k+1;

Basic

k=0

FOR i=90 TO 585

IF i MOD 40 = 7 THEN k=k+1

NEXT i

ШАЯ

k:=0;

НЦ Для i От 90 До 585

Если mod(i, 40) = 7 То k:=k+1;

КЦ

 12

287. Задание {{ 382 }} ТЗ № 382

Отметьте правильный ответ

Определите, чему равно k после выполнения программы:

Pascal

K:=0;

For i:=70 To 665 Do

If i mod 20 = 9 Then k:=k+1;

Basic

k=0

FOR i=70 TO 665

IF i MOD 20 = 9 THEN k=k+1

NEXT i

ШАЯ

k:=0;

НЦ Для i От 70 До 665

Если mod(i, 20) = 9 То k:=k+1;

КЦ

 29

288. Задание {{ 383 }} ТЗ № 383

Отметьте правильный ответ

Определите, чему равно S после выполнения программы.

Pascal

S:=0;

For i:=1 To 123 Do

S:=S + i div 28;

Basic

S=0

FOR i=1 TO 123

S=S + INT(i/28)

NEXT i

ШАЯ

S:=0;

НЦ Для i От 1 До 123

S=S + INT(i/28);

КЦ

 216

289. Задание {{ 384 }} ТЗ № 384

Отметьте правильный ответ

Определите, чему равно S после выполнения программы.

Pascal

S:=0;

For i:=1 To 149 Do

S:=S + i div 28;

Basic

S=0

FOR i=1 TO 149

S=S + INT(i/28)

NEXT i

ШАЯ

S:=0;

НЦ Для i От 1 До 149

S=S + INT(i/28);

КЦ

 330

290. Задание {{ 385 }} ТЗ № 385

Отметьте правильный ответ

Определите, чему равно S после выполнения программы.

Pascal

S:=0;

For i:=1 To 146 Do

S:=S + i div 33;

Basic

S=0

FOR i=1 TO 146

S=S + INT(i/33)

NEXT i

ШАЯ

S:=0;

НЦ Для i От 1 До 146

S=S + INT(i/33);

КЦ

 258

291. Задание {{ 386 }} ТЗ № 386

Отметьте правильный ответ

Определите, чему равно S после выполнения программы.

Pascal

S:=0;

For i:=1 To 123 Do

S:=S + i div 29;

Basic

S=0

FOR i=1 TO 123

S=S + INT(i/29)

NEXT i

ШАЯ

S:=0;

НЦ Для i От 1 До 123

S=S + INT(i/29);

КЦ

 206

292. Задание {{ 387 }} ТЗ № 387

Отметьте правильный ответ

Определите, чему равно S после выполнения программы.

Pascal

S:=0;

For i:=1 To 148 Do

S:=S + i div 32;

Basic

S=0

FOR i=1 TO 148

S=S + INT(i/32)

NEXT i

ШАЯ

S:=0;

НЦ Для i От 1 До 148

S=S + INT(i/32);

КЦ

 276

293. Задание {{ 388 }} ТЗ № 388

Отметьте правильный ответ

Определите значение S после выполнения программы. Ответ записать в виде рациональной дроби.

Pascal

S:=10;

For i:=1 To 79 Do

S:=S * i / (i + 1);

Basic

S=10

FOR i=1 TO 79

S=S * i / (i + 1)

NEXT I

ШАЯ

S:=10;

НЦ Для i От 1 До 79

S=S * i / (i + 1)

КЦ

 1/8

294. Задание {{ 389 }} ТЗ № 389

Отметьте правильный ответ

Определите значение S после выполнения программы. Ответ записать в виде рациональной дроби.

Pascal

S:=5;

For i:=1 To 49 Do

S:=S * i / (i + 1);

Basic

S=5

FOR i=1 TO 49

S=S * i / (i + 1)

NEXT I

ШАЯ

S:=5;

НЦ Для i От 1 До 49

S=S * i / (i + 1)

КЦ

 1/10

295. Задание {{ 390 }} ТЗ № 390

Отметьте правильный ответ

Определите значение S после выполнения программы. Ответ записать в виде рациональной дроби.

Pascal

S:=5;

For i:=1 To 59 Do

S:=S * i / (i + 1);

Basic

S=5

FOR i=1 TO 59

S=S * i / (i + 1)

NEXT I

ШАЯ

S:=5;

НЦ Для i От 1 До 59

S=S * i / (i + 1)

КЦ

 1/12

296. Задание {{ 391 }} ТЗ № 391

Отметьте правильный ответ

Определите значение S после выполнения программы. Ответ записать в виде рациональной дроби.

Pascal

S:=10;

For i:=1 To 139 Do

S:=S * i / (i + 1);

Basic

S=10

FOR i=1 TO 139

S=S * i / (i + 1)

NEXT I

ШАЯ

S:=10;

НЦ Для i От 1 До 139

S=S * i / (i + 1)

КЦ

 1/14

297. Задание {{ 392 }} ТЗ № 392

Отметьте правильный ответ

Определите значение S после выполнения программы. Ответ записать в виде рациональной дроби.

Pascal

S:=10;

For i:=1 To 79 Do

S:=S * i / (i + 1);

Basic

S=10

FOR i=1 TO 79

S=S * i / (i + 1)

NEXT I

ШАЯ

S:=10;

НЦ Для i От 1 До 79

S=S * i / (i + 1)

КЦ

 1/8

298. Задание {{ 393 }} ТЗ № 393

Отметьте правильный ответ

Определите, значение S после выполнения программы. Ответ записать в виде рациональной дроби.

Pascal

S:=10;

For i:=1 To 109 Do

S:=S * i / (i + 1);

Basic

S=10

FOR i=1 TO 109

S=S * i / (i + 1)

NEXT I

ШАЯ

S:=10;

НЦ Для i От 1 До 109

S=S * i / (i + 1)

КЦ

 1/11

299. Задание {{ 394 }} ТЗ № 394

Отметьте правильный ответ

Задана матрица A(N, N). Определить сумму элементов расположенных выше главной диагонали матрицы (элементы главной диагонали не суммируются). Для решения задачи предлагается алгоритм, содержащий ошибку. Определите строку с ошибкой.

1

2

3

4

Pascal

S:=0;

For i:=1 To N-2 Do

For j:=i+1 to N Do

S:=s+A[i,j];

Basic

S=0

FOR i=1 TO N-2

FOR j = i+1 TO N

S=s+A(i,j)

NEXT j

NEXT i

ШАЯ

S:=0;

НЦ Для i От 1 До N-2

НЦ Для j От i+1 До N

S:=s+a[i,j];

КЦ

КЦ

 2

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]